Lisa Faulkner recalls 'very dark time' as she battled fertility (2024)

Lisa Faulkner has opened up about a 'very dark time' in her life where she underwent three rounds of unsuccessful IVF and suffered anectopic pregnancy.

The actress, 52, was at the time wed to EastEndersactor Chris Coghill, 49, with whom she went on to adopt daughter Billie, now 18, before divorcing in 2014 after six-years of marriage.

She also lifted the lid on her first date with now husband and MasterChef judgeJohn Torode, 59, branding it a 'leap of faith' after 'failing' at her first marriage.

Lisa told Good Housekeeping:'Those years [battling infertility] were a very dark time. One minute I wasn't that bothered about kids, apart from my nieces, and then something happened overnight and I wanted a baby so badly'.

'All my peers were trying at the same time, so it was like we were swimming in the same pool, but they kept getting pregnant and climbing out until, eventually, I was still swimming in there alone. It was really lonely.

She continued: When people would tell me they were pregnant I'd try to be fine, but I'd go home and be full of shame, anger and sadness. When I had IVF, it was with an amazing doctor with whom nine out of 10 patients got pregnant – and I was the one in 10 who didn't. I thought, 'Why me?' It was exhausting.'

Lisa and Chris adopted Billie at 17-months which she described as a 'completely different ballgame' to conceiving a child.

Telling the publication: 'It's not easy, because you're dealing with a child with trauma. It's a trauma that will never, ever be healed, and my job is to be there to help make it better in every way I can'.

She added: I've had to do a lot of work on myself. It's an ongoing process; it doesn't stop.'

Lisa also spoke about her own trauma after losing her mother Julie at the age of just 16, revealing that the pain and grief 'never really goes away'.

'When it’s immediate, it’s like a sick feeling you can’t get away from; and then you wake up one day and it’s a bit easier. You realise you can laugh about something they did or hear their voice without crying'.

'And then, 20 years later, someone can ask you about it and you’ll feel this bubble rising up and you burst into tears. So it never really goes away'.

Recalling her first date with John, who she met on Celebrity MasterChef and wed in 2019, Lisa revealed they went for dinner where they got on brilliantly.

'We took things really slowly because of Billie, and also because I'd been through the end of a marriage – we had a child and I felt I'd failed in something I never wanted to fail at'.

Read More John Torode enjoys a casual outing with wife Lisa Faulkner as the pair step out on a dog walk in London

'I never give up on anything, so when you do have to accept that something didn't work, starting a new relationship is a big leap of faith.'

The couple, who present their own ITV cooking showJohn & Lisa’s Weekend Kitchen, have now ventured into writing recipe book together.

'It’s taken a while to make it happen, but we’re thrilled with it. It has recipes from the latest series and favourites from other series, too. John is a brilliant chef and I’m a home cook, but we both just want to make food everyone can enjoy'.

'He’s never made me feel like I don’t know what I’m talking about. We’ve learned from each other – I’ll tell him tips or cheats that I have and he’ll say, ‘Actually, that’s good'.

Together they share five children: Lisa's adopted daughter Billie and John's kids, Jonah, 18, and Lulu, 16, from a former marriage and grown up sons Casper and Marselle, whom he shares with his first wife.

Last yearLisa opened up on the secret to her happy marriage with John,sayingtheir partnership works because they 'really like and fancy each other', before going on to gush over her husband's 'caring side'.
